Is this the same as the map inside the game?

No. Partner pins appear on the public Land Registry map at prospectour.co.uk/map/ — the web map anyone can browse. The game world players walk around in is separate and is not changed by a partner pin.

Does a pin give me the map square my shop sits on?

No. Prospectour is a game, and squares in it are claimed by players. A partner pin is a marker on the web map pointing at your business — it gives you no rights over the square, and no rights over real-world land either.

What does it cost?

The partner programme is just starting, so there is no standard price list yet. Tell us about your business and we will come back to you with the detail before anything goes live.

Can I have my pin taken down later?

Yes, and you do not need us to do it. Sign in at prospectour.co.uk/partners/manage with a one-time code sent to your email, and you can update your listing or remove your pin yourself. There is nothing to cancel and no minimum term.

Do I have to send a logo?

No, but it is worth it. Your listing appears in the partner directory either way; the scrolling banner of partners on our home page only shows businesses that sent a logo. You can add or change one at any time from the manage page.
